The La Quinta Inn Daytona Beach is the place to stay for visitors to Daytona International Speedway. Enjoy the Atlantic Ocean and sprawling sandy beaches. You can catch seafaring ships from the Ponce Inlet Lighthouse or try your luck at the Greyhound Dog Race Track. You will find LPGA Championship Golf Courses and the USTA Tennis Center here, and even some unique attractions such as: The World's Largest Outdoor Flea Market and The World's Largest Harley Davidson Dealership, Walt Disney World, Kennedy Space Center and Universal Studios are easily accessible from here.
When you return to the La Quinta Inn Daytona Beach after a day of fun, our courteous and helpful staff will be waiting. We have an on-site Restaurant and a Sports bar. All spacious rooms are interior corridor with a patio and lots of helpful amenities. We have a sparkling Swimming pool and a large sundeck with shaded tables.

We stayed two nights and had a quiet and peaceful rest. I might suggest that they have the large luggage carts available for unloading your luggage into your room. None were available and we are both disabled. The handicap room met all our needs and they even moved a frig/microwave into the room at our request. The pool and hot tub have the handicap "pool lifts" where you can safely lower someone into the water. The amenities on the La Quinta property did not show a hot tub so they might want to update that as we always look for one when shopping around. All the staff went over the top to assist us. We requested a late checkout and they extended us to 2:00 PM which really helped us out. The breakfast area could use a remodel to provide more space for diners. It became very congested and the fresh fruit is actually not in the area with the rest of the food. We thought they didn't have any and by the time we discovered someone with one they had run out. We saw no evidence of insects in the room and they have large flat screen TV's. The room temp was easy to regulate and I suggest setting the fan on constant low at night so it doesn't wake you coming on and off to cool or heat. Another surprise was an ice cream vending machine. I hadn't had an orange dreamsicle in a long time. « less

I read the reviews here before booking and I felt that since we only needed to stay one night I'd give it a try. I'm glad we only needed a one night stay. For the price, the room was relatively clean and the staff was friendly. The rooms are a nice size too. However, I was woken up several times throughout the night due to other guests having loud conversations in the hallway and someone partying in the pool area around 3am. When I was finally able to fall back to sleep I was woken up around 7am with someone blasting what sounded like techno music very loudly from their room for about 45 minutes. I'm a pretty heavy sleeper too normally. I know it's not the hotel's fault that some people have no consideration for others, but after a long day of driving this was not a very restful place to stay. There are several buildings to this hotel and your room key card is required to gain access to each building. However, there were some people in our building partying in the parking lot for some reason and they kept propping the "secure" door open which I didn't appreciate since it defeats the purpose of having a secure entry. So needless to say I would not stay at this hotel again based on the experience with the kind of people this price point and location seem to attract. « less
